Subject: DR drill Thursday — report exports

Hi team, quick heads-up: this week's disaster-recovery drill covers the Glimmerport report exporter, specifically the timezone handling bug where exports rendered in the failover region's local time. We'll fail over, run an export, and confirm timestamps stay in account-configured zones. To unseal the standby exporter during the drill, use the recovery passphrase below.

strongbox words: fraath-isteth

# Gallery Guide — Maintainer Notes

WhisperDock serves audio tracks for the Calverton Hall exhibits app. Tracks are stored in the Reliquary asset service; the app fetches manifests at startup and caches for 24h. Do not bump the manifest schema without updating the kiosk build. Tours are keyed by room slug, not exhibit ID — legacy decision, don't fight it. All Reliquary calls require an internal key, rotated quarterly. Current key follows.

gateway credential: kto7_GoY89Me

Welcome to the Chronoplan support rotation. Chronoplan is Bellgrave Software's timetable solver for secondary schools; it ingests room lists, teacher availability, and subject constraints, then emits candidate schedules overnight. Most tickets involve infeasible constraint sets, so always check the solver log before escalating. The worker pool authenticates to the scheduling queue with a shared credential, loaded from the staging env file. The next line of that file sets it.

env line for fafof-fahag: LEDGER_TOKEN5=f8790